Transaction ed59cbb029b14f0ba7ff5d6b6681e3284e056740f34a6142432e72a690a5d5b7
1 Input
1 Output
-
ed59cbb029b14f0ba7ff5d6b6681e3284e056740f34a6142432e72a690a5d5b7:0
- value
- 22657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2c5cd55258bae0f1f22ca7c20d4a07f8804cfb05 OP_EQUAL
- address
- 35jas9tzsvBbWgpkDh6gJd95drAU6rAHDQ